This map is included as Plate � in Appendlix.l. <br /> 3.0 HISTORICAL RESEARCH <br /> 3.1 Aerial Photographs <br /> Live Oak reviewed aerial photographs of the Site provided by the San Joaquin County <br /> Surveyor's Office in Stockton, California. The available photographs were dated 1937, <br /> 1952, 1963, 1975, and 1983. Two additional photographs, dated October 1998 and <br /> June 2007, were obtained from the San Joaquin County District Viewer. <br /> In the 1937 photo, the Site appears to be an orchard. An irrigation canal defines the <br /> southwest corner and southern property line of the Site. Surrounding properties are <br /> vineyards, orchards, and rural residences. <br /> In the 1952 photo, the Site appears to be a vineyard. No other significant changes are <br /> apparent. <br /> In the 1963 photos, the adjacent properties to the west appear to be open agricultural <br /> land. No other significant changes are apparent. <br /> In the 1975 photo, commercial structures can be seen to the northeast. No other <br /> significant changes are apparent. <br /> In the 1983 photo, the Site appears to be orchard. A new residential subdivision can be <br /> seen to the north and west of the Site, and a new orchard can also be seen to the west. <br /> In the 1998 photo, the residential subdivision to the west has been expanded. A new <br /> commercial structure can be seen to the east. <br /> In the 2007 photo, the Site appears to be open land.
